A lawsuit threat is a formal warning of potential legal action used to pressure compliance, settle disputes, or deter behavior. It often benefits plaintiffs seeking compensation or negotiation leverage, while defendants may use it to protect reputations or avoid costly litigation. Commonly employed in business, personal injury, or contract conflicts, it serves as a strategic tool before court proceedings.
